Photos of tiny two-week old babies snoozing will melt your heart - PHOTO

Most parents these days are no strangers to snapping endless photos of their newborns but we'd hazard a guess that they'd love a few more snaps of them sleeping - not least because we all know a sleeping baby can be a rare thing.

And of course a sleeping baby can also be a very cute thing, as these adorable pictures show, especially within the first two weeks of their life when they are at their most teeny and delicate.Because tiny babies have much more soft cartilage in their bones at first, they are still comfortable curling themselves into comfy, and very heart-string-pulling positions to be photographed while they have a little snooze.These beautiful pictures show sleeping babies that they have captured on camera within two weeks of being born.During this time of their brand new lives, a baby has around 300 soft cartilage bones.As they grow, these fuse together to make 206 bones.As they have more of these soft cartilage bones in their first two weeks they are more comfortable to sleep with their legs tucked under their bottoms, mimicking the positions they took in the womb.These compacted positions are very unique to the first 14 days, as after this period they get used to stretching out while sleeping in their cribs.‘They no longer adopt the unique foetal positions showing how important it is to capture this limited moment in your baby’s life,’ says Richard Mayfield, Creative Director of Venture Photography.‘We know how important those moments are.'Just seeing the change in images people take with their smart phones over the weeks, it is clear how much your baby will grow and develop.’All the images taken were from proud parents bringing in their new-borns to Venture studios across the UK so they could capture their first two weeks of life.(dailymail.co.uk)Bakudaily.az
